Matvei Shuravin (Russian: Матвей Шуравин; born 22 March 2006) is a Russian professional ice hockey player for HC Zvezda Moscow of the Supreme Hockey League (VHL) as a prospect to CSKA Moscow of the Kontinental Hockey League (KHL). He considered a top prospect eligible for the 2024 NHL Entry Draft.[1]

Playing career[edit]

Shuravin, known for being a mobile defenseman, earned a “A” rating in NHL Central Scouting's initial watch list.[2]
